The Dark Side of the Enlightenment: Wizards, Alchemists, and Spiritual Seekers in the Age of Reason
Wizards, Alchemists, and Spiritual Seekers in the Age of Reason
2013
EN
Why spiritual and supernatural yearnings, even investigations into the occult, flourished in the era of rationalist philosophy.In The Dark Side of the Enlightenment, John V. Fleming shows how the impulses of the European Enlightenment—generally associated with great strides in the liberation of human thought from superstition and traditional religion—were challenged by tenacious religious ideas or channeled into the “darker” pursuits of the esoteric and the occult. Hertzian Wave Wireless Telegraphy by John Ambrose Fleming is a seminal work that delves into the early principles and practical applications of wireless telegraphy, a revolutionary technology at the turn of the 20th century. The book provides a comprehensive exploration of the scientific foundations laid by Heinrich Hertz, whose experiments with electromagnetic waves paved the way for wireless communication. Waves and Ripples in Water, Air, and Aether by Sir William Henry Bragg is a classic scientific treatise that explores the fascinating phenomena of wave motion in various mediums. Originally published in 1910, this book offers a comprehensive and accessible introduction to the principles of wave theory, making it suitable for both students and general readers interested in physics and natural science.
